Kelly Chen is an experienced production professional with a strong background in managing and executing commercial shoots. As a Production Manager at Day One Agency, Kelly oversaw budgets for high-profile clients such as Amazon and Chipotle, while also coordinating external crews and logistics. Previously, as a Line Producer at Superconductor, Kelly facilitated seamless communication among departments and managed essential production resources. Kelly's experience includes a role as a Production Coordinator at A+E Networks and educational contributions as a Justice, Equity, Diversity & Inclusion Educator at the University of Southern California. Early career experiences include an internship at Warner Bros. Entertainment focusing on music research and a writing position at Oculus VR, contributing to a virtual reality game. Kelly holds a Bachelor's degree in Music and Film Studies from the University of Southern California.

Megalomedia is a full-service television and film studio developing and producing original content for U.S. and international broadcasters. With offices in Austin, TX and London, Megalomedia’s passion is to share the most compelling worlds, authentic characters and engaging stories out there. Since our first broadcast in 2008, our original non-fiction programming has been connecting with millions of viewers around the world. The range of programing we’ve produced is as varied as the audiences it’s captivated. From the cross-country adventures of transporters hauling one-of-a kind items in Shipping Wars and Shipping Wars UK, to the life-altering weight loss documentaries that share the transformational experiences of the individuals and their families on My 600-lb Life, Skin Tight and Heavy, or the life threatening scenarios faced everyday on the job in Marshal Law: TX and Smokejumpers.
